How to Change the Coolant in a 2006 Yamaha YZ250

The 2006 Yamaha YZ250 is a legendary two-stroke dirt bike, prized for its lightweight chassis and aggressive power delivery. Regular coolant changes are vital for maintaining peak performance and protecting the engine from overheating, especially given this model's aluminum components and intense riding conditions. What You Need
- High quality ethylene glycol antifreeze with anti-corrosion properties (designed for aluminum engines)
- Clean soft water (distilled or deionized recommended)
- Coolant catch pan
- 10 mm socket or wrench
- Funnel
- Clean rags
- Protective gloves
YZ250-Specific Notes
- This model's cooling system capacity is 1.20 L (1.27 US qt).
- Use a 50% coolant/50% soft water mix for best results and engine longevity.
- The coolant drain bolt is on the right side of the engine. Always replace the copper washer under the bolt if damaged.
- Torque the drain bolt to 10 Nm (7.2 ft–lb) after draining and before refilling.2
Step-by-Step Coolant Change Guide
-
Allow Engine to Completely Cool
Never open the radiator cap or drain bolt when hot—the system is under pressure and can release boiling coolant. -
Remove the Radiator Cap
Carefully loosen and remove the cap to allow airflow and ensure full drainage. -
Drain the Old Coolant
Place your catch pan under the right side of the engine.
Locate the coolant drain bolt (typically near the water pump). Use a 10 mm socket to remove the bolt along with the sealing washer.
Let all coolant flow out. Tip the bike gently side-to-side to clear trapped fluid from the radiators.2 -
Flush the System (Recommended)
Reinstall the drain bolt and temporarily fill the system with clean soft water.
Replace the cap, run the engine for a couple of minutes, then shut off and allow to cool.
Drain the water as before. This helps clear contaminants and old coolant.3 -
Reinstall the Drain Bolt
Ensure the sealing washer is in good condition.
Torque the drain bolt to 10 Nm (7.2 ft-lb) for a proper seal. -
Mix and Add New Coolant
Mix 50% high-quality coolant with 50% soft water.
Pour into the radiator using a funnel until coolant reaches the neck of the filler.
Gently tilt the bike side to side to release trapped air. Top off as needed.2 -
Bleed the System
Briefly run the motor with the cap off, allowing any remaining air bubbles to escape.
Watch for drops in coolant level and top off as necessary.4 -
Inspect and Replace the Cap
Ensure the radiator cap gasket is intact.
Replace the cap and wipe away any excess coolant from the bike and engine. -
Check for Leaks
After a short ride, double-check the coolant level and inspect the drain bolt and hoses for leaks.
Pro Tips for YZ250 Owners
- Inspect hoses for age cracks—replace as needed to prevent future leaks.
- Never use pure antifreeze; always dilute 50/50 with soft water. This ensures proper heat transfer and anti-corrosion protection.
- Flush and replace coolant at least once a year, or more frequently for high-intensity or hot-climate riding.
- Carry spare premixed coolant when riding remote tracks. Overheating from leaks can be catastrophic for your engine.
